Why AI matters at this scale

Synergy Services is a mid-sized non-profit organization based in Parkville, Missouri, with 201–500 employees. As a community-focused entity, it likely delivers a range of human services—from youth programs to crisis intervention—relying heavily on donor funding, grants, and volunteer support. At this size, the organization faces the classic non-profit dilemma: growing demand for services with limited administrative bandwidth. AI offers a path to amplify impact without proportionally increasing overhead.

1. Donor Intelligence & Fundraising Optimization

Non-profits like Synergy Services often maintain a donor database (e.g., Salesforce Nonprofit Cloud) but lack the analytical capacity to segment donors effectively. AI can cluster supporters by giving history, engagement, and capacity, then generate personalized appeal messages. This can lift donation conversion rates by 20–30%, directly boosting revenue. The ROI is immediate: a $30M organization could see an additional $500K–$1M in annual contributions with minimal investment.

2. Grant Writing & Reporting Automation

Grant applications and impact reports consume hundreds of staff hours. Generative AI can draft initial sections, synthesize program data into narratives, and even tailor language to specific funders. While human oversight remains critical, AI can cut drafting time by 50%, allowing development teams to pursue more grants. For a mid-sized non-profit, this could mean an extra 2–3 submitted proposals per month, potentially unlocking $200K+ in new funding.

3. Volunteer & Resource Matching

Coordinating hundreds of volunteers across multiple programs is a logistical headache. AI-powered matching algorithms can align volunteer skills, availability, and interests with open opportunities, while automating reminders and feedback collection. This reduces coordinator workload by 10–15 hours per week, enabling staff to focus on high-touch community engagement.

Deployment Risks for Mid-Sized Non-Profits

Despite the promise, AI adoption carries risks. Data privacy is paramount—donor and client information must be protected, especially when using cloud-based AI tools. Bias in algorithms could inadvertently skew service delivery or fundraising toward certain demographics. Additionally, with limited IT staff, the organization may struggle to integrate AI into legacy systems. A phased approach, starting with low-code tools and vendor solutions with strong non-profit support, is advisable. Staff training and change management are essential to avoid resistance and ensure ethical use.

For Synergy Services, the AI journey begins with a donor analytics pilot, leveraging existing CRM data. Success there can build momentum for broader automation, ultimately enabling the organization to serve more people with the same resources.

Frequently asked

Common questions about AI for non-profit & social services

How can a non-profit afford AI tools?
Many AI platforms offer nonprofit discounts; start with free tiers of tools like ChatGPT or low-cost automation via Zapier.
Is donor data safe with AI?
Yes, if you use enterprise-grade AI with data encryption and comply with GDPR/CCPA; avoid sharing sensitive data with public models.
What's the easiest AI win for a non-profit?
AI-powered donor segmentation using your existing CRM data can boost fundraising ROI by 20-30%.
Can AI help with grant writing?
Generative AI can draft grant sections, but human review is essential to ensure accuracy and alignment with funder priorities.
Will AI replace our staff?
No, AI augments staff by automating repetitive tasks, allowing them to focus on mission-critical work.
What are the risks of AI in non-profits?
Bias in algorithms, data privacy breaches, and over-reliance on AI without human oversight are key risks.
How do we start with AI?
Begin with a pilot project, like using AI for donor analytics, and measure impact before scaling.
